Building Lasting Bonds: Cultivating Customer Loyalty

Customer loyalty stands as a pillar for sustainable growth and success. While many businesses focus on acquiring new customers, nurturing existing relationships is equally – if not more – important. In this article, we’ll explore actionable strategies for small propane business owners to cultivate lasting loyalty among their clientele.

Understanding Customer Loyalty

Customer loyalty goes beyond mere satisfaction; it embodies a deep-rooted connection between consumers and businesses. Loyal customers not only continue to patronize your services but also advocate for your brand, driving referrals and bolstering your reputation within the community.

Personalized Customer Service

In the realm of propane provision, personalized service can make all the difference. Understand your customers’ unique needs and preferences. Whether it’s scheduling deliveries at convenient times or offering tailored solutions for their energy requirements, demonstrating attentiveness fosters a sense of value and appreciation.

Consistent Quality and Reliability

Reliability is paramount in the propane business. Consistently delivering on promises, such as timely deliveries and accurate billing, instills trust and reliability in your customer base. Prioritize safety measures and adhere to industry standards to reassure customers of your commitment to their well-being.

Effective Communication

Clear and transparent communication is key to building trust and rapport with customers. Keep clients informed about service updates, pricing changes, and any relevant industry developments. Promptly address any concerns or inquiries they may have, demonstrating your dedication to their satisfaction.

Rewarding Loyalty

Implementing loyalty programs or rewards systems can incentivize repeat business and strengthen customer allegiance. Offer discounts, referral bonuses, or exclusive perks to loyal patrons, showcasing your appreciation for their continued support. Simple gestures can go a long way in fostering goodwill and long-term loyalty.

Seeking Feedback and Continuous Improvement

Encourage customer feedback and actively seek input on how to enhance your services. Use surveys, reviews, and direct communication channels to gather insights into areas for improvement. By demonstrating a willingness to listen and adapt, you show customers that their opinions matter, fostering a sense of partnership and commitment.

Fostering customer loyalty is a multifaceted endeavor that requires dedication, empathy, and consistent effort. Remember, loyalty is not merely earned – it’s nurtured through genuine care, strong communication, and commitment to customer satisfaction.
